Understanding Door Handles and Their Components
Door handles are composed of numerous parts, each serving a particular purpose. The main components of a common door handle consist of:
Handle or Knob: The part that is grasped by the user to open or close the door.Rosette or Escutcheon: The ornamental plate that covers the opening in the door where the handle and locking mechanism are fitted.Latch Mechanism: This is the internal mechanism that holds the door closed and is generally triggered by the handle.Spindle: A metal rod that connects the outdoors handle to the inside handle, enabling them to run in unison.Strike Plate: The metal piece attached to the door frame that the lock mechanism engages with when the door is closed.Types of Door Handles

Changing a door handle is an uncomplicated procedure that can be accomplished with some fundamental tools and knowledge. The list below actions describe how to change door handle parts successfully:
Tools Required:Screwdriver (flathead and Phillips)Allen wrench (if relevant)Drill (for brand-new installations)LevelDetermining tapeReplacement handle setStep-by-Step Guide:
Remove the Old Handle:
Begin by loosening the handle utilizing the proper screwdriver. If there are concealed screws, you might need to pry off the rosette or escutcheon to access them.As soon as the screws are removed, separate the 2 halves of the handle.
Remove the Latch Mechanism:
Unscrew the lock mechanism from the edge of the door. Pull it out carefully to avoid harming the door.
Insert the New Latch:
Position the new lock mechanism in the exact same slot, ensuring it lines up with the door's edge and screw holes for a safe and secure fit.
Set Up the New Handle:
Slide the spindle through the latch and connect both halves of the handle. Secure them with screws.If there's a rosette or trim piece, reattach it to cover any exposed screws.
Check the Mechanism:
Ensure that the handle operates smoothly and the lock engages appropriately with the strike plate.Make any necessary modifications.

Q1: How do I know which replacement parts I need for my door handle?A: Identify the type and brand of your present handle, and examine the measurements for the spindle length, latch size, and total handle style. Lots of hardware stores can assist match parts by providing sample fittings.

Q2: Can I change a door handle without professional help?A: Yes, replacing a door handle is a workable DIY job. Follow the steps detailed above, and utilize care with tools to make sure safety.

Q3: What should I do if my door handle is not basic size?A: If you find your door handle is non-standard, think about checking out a specialized hardware shop or online merchant that offers customized or universal door handle services.

Q4: How can I enhance the security of my door handle setup?A: To enhance door security, think about changing basic handles with models that include deadbolts, smart locks, or strengthened materials designed to hold up against tampering.
